According to this, a broadscale benthic habitat is in good condition according to criterion D6C3 if at least 10% of its area is not permanently impaired (no physical stress) and the severely impaired occurrence area is less than 25% of the total occurrence area of the habitat. (Nationally determined threshold)

The criterion D6C4 (surface area of the benthic habitat) cannot be assessed at present. An indicator measuring the loss of surface area due to anthropogenic interference is currently being developed in OSPAR in cooperation between Germany and the United Kingdom.
|
For the OSPAR indicator state of the benthic communities: Regional sublittoral habitats have also not been defined at regional level. No assessment of the benthic habitats was carried out using a nationally determined threshold, as the current state of development of the indicator does not ensure a representative assessment of national habitats from a technical point of view.

For this criterion, the surface of a benthic habitat is in a good condition, where all the thresholds of the individual assessments available for it are met. For a representative assessment, more than 50 % of the habitat?s meeting space must have been assessed at national and/or EU level. A benthic habitat is in good environmental status according to criterion D6C5 if the threshold is not met in less than 25 % of the assessed area (also national).
